PM to inaugurate Sheikh Lutfur Rahman Bridge in Tungipara

Update : 23 Jan 2015, 01:46 PM

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ina will inaugurate the Patgati Sheikh Lutfur Rahman Bridge in Tungipara of Gopalganj  through a video conference at the Gono Bhaban on Satureday.

The Roads and Highway Department of Gopalganj has taken all preparations for the inauguration of the bridge named after the prime minister's grand father, Sheikh Lutfur Rahman.

Earlier on Friday, Road Transportation and Bridges Minister Obaidul Quader visited the bridge site.

With inauguration of the bridge, a new horizon will be opened up for the people in the country's south and south-western region as it will reduce around 25 kilometer highway connection between the capital and Bagerhat, Pirojpur, Jhalokathi and Bargona.

With cost of Tk72.65 crore, the Roads and Highway Department of Gopalganj has constructed the bridge over the Madhumati river, said sources in the Gopalganj Roads and Highway Department.

On December 23, 2000, Sheikh Hasina had laid the foundation station of the 391.491 meter long bridge to connect Pirojpur and Bagerhat district, they said.

But the BNP-Jamaat government government had stopped the construction in 2001. 

After assuming the power, the Awami League led government again started the construction work in 2009.

Abul Kalam Azad, an engineer of RP Construction which constructed the bridge, said the bridge could be used for 100 years.
